Hi, my plant got Droopy leaves after going from soil to water. I already gave fresh water, but it didnt help. What can I do to help the plant?

    “going from soil to water” means lots of the fine root hairs likely got ripped off and your plant is struggling to uptake enough water. Make sure the water is somewhat fresh and doesn’t get stale and the humidity in the room isn’t too low. Especially warm air from a radiator will cause dry air – which your plant doesn’t like at all. You can already see the tips of the leaves browning/drying off.
